Subject: Doclint cut-over complete

Hi — welcome aboard. Over the weekend we moved the Marigold documentation linter from the old cron-based runner to the new Fennel pipeline. All style rules carried over, and the broken-link checker now runs on every pull request rather than nightly. One rule set (terminology) is temporarily disabled pending review by the Oakhurst docs team. So you can get oriented quickly, the pipeline's active configuration is reproduced here.

config for bahof-tagep:
kelael:
  pin: 3701
  tenant: fraius
  seal: seal_566287a7
  metrics_host: metrics.kelael.ferradyn.local
  standby_team: sormir
  escalation: juldor-oliir
  nonce: 530523

### Step 4: Migrate the Tide-Table Widget

Swap `TideGridLegacy` for `TidePane` in `widgets/index`. The new component reads station predictions from the `tides_v2` schema, not the flat file. Run `scripts/backfill_tides.sh` once per environment before merging—it takes about two minutes. Confirm the harmonic coefficients table has 37 columns; fewer means the backfill was interrupted. The widget's data loader resolves its database target from the entry below.

primary connection of kahof-kagep = mssql://belath_svc:3uqY4g6LHG5Nyi@db-d0ba.ferralabs.corp:5432/rusdor

## Step 4: Upgrade the broker

Time to bump Pipewren from 3.x to 4.0. Drain consumers first — seriously, don't skip this, the 4.0 rebalance protocol will drop unacked messages otherwise. Upgrade brokers one at a time, waiting for partition sync between each. If a node won't rejoin, roll it back and ping whoever's secondary on-call. Once the cluster is healthy, apply the new config values shown below.

service settings:
PRAIX_LOG_LEVEL=error
PRAIX_METRICS_HOST=metrics.praix.qorvelcorp.corp
PRAIX_POOL_SIZE=16